Let me try and get this straight, because the concept of this char is a little confusing to me.

She was a full blown Denarian once, but found redemtion?... If that's the case, where does the Shadow come from?
Taking up the coin, being a monster for a while and then finding redemption and discarding the coin removes the shadow of the fallen, and would also take with it all the power she'd get from being possessed.

The only way she could have a shadow in her head, would be for her to be in the same situation as Harry was in after Death Masks. Having touched a coin, but not given in to the Denarian.

In my opinion the high concept doesn't fit the powers. An Ex-Nickelhead would not have access to sponsored magic.

Maybe if you call her a "Junior Nickelhead" instead... but then the whole redemption idea wouldn't fit.

Sorry for all that... I'm not trying to pry apart your character, I just see some inconsistencies with it.
